Media Advisory: Governor Candidate Forum on Environmental Issues

Governor Candidate Forum on January 24

Twenty-six environmental and conservation groups are hosting a forum for gubernatorial candidates to share their vision about air, water, land, and outdoor legacy issues in Minnesota. The event location, Hamline University’s Anne Simley Theatre, has filled free tickets to capacity and satellite locations are being organized throughout the state. Interested parties should register for a remote ticket to watch a live stream at home or a satellite location. There’s a waitlist for Anne Simley Theatre where the event will also be televised in the lobby. Registered participants will be able to submit and vote on preferred questions using the pigeonhole.at website. To reserve a media-designated seat, please contact Sara Wolff at sara@mepartnership.org.

Event Details

Wednesday, January 24, 2018
6:30 – 8:30pm Candidate Forum
8:30 – 9:30pm Reception and Mingling

Anne Simley Theatre at Hamline University
1530 W. Taylor Ave., St. Paul

Moderated by:
Elizabeth Dunbar, MPR
Dave Orrick, Pioneer Press

Invitations were extended to six candidates from each party. The following have confirmed attendance:

Rebecca Otto, State Auditor
Rep. Erin Murphy
Chris Coleman, Former Mayor of St. Paul
Rep. Paul Thissen
Rep. Tina Liebling
U.S. Rep. Tim Walz
